Identification and characterization of functional modules reflecting transcriptome transition during human neuron maturation

2017-08-10

Abstract excerpt

<h4>Background</h4> Neuron maturation is a critical process in neurogenesis, during which neurons gain their morphological, electrophysiological and molecular characteristics for their functions as the central components of the nervous system. <h4>Results</h4> To better understand the molecular changes during this process, we combined the protein-protein interaction network and public single cell RNA-seq data of...
